Good-quality skewers have acorn safety nuts with steel serrations that can bite into the face of the dropout, so the wheel won’t slip, but most of the skewers have soft aluminum parts in this position, presumably to save weight.
There is a lever on one end of the quick-release, and an adjusting nut on the other end. Never add spacers, washers, etc. to a wheel quick-release device that would decrease the thread engagement of the adjusting nut.
